Definition

  1. 1
    kleiner, punktförmiger, mit dem bloßen Auge erkennbarer Himmelskörper
  2. 2
    fünf- oder sechszackiges, kleines Symbol (Asteriskus)
  3. 3
    Kosebezeichnung für einen geliebten oder verehrten Menschen
  4. 4
    Symbol mit mehreren Strahlen, die gewöhnlich im gleichen Winkel zueinander stehen
  5. 5
    (weniger bekannte oder wichtige) Berühmtheit, Prominenter

Recorded use

Wiktionary examples

These source excerpts show how Sternchen app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.

  1. Am Himmel funkeln die Sternchen.
  2. „Das Kleid war in London gekauft worden, und es war mit blauen Blümchen und Sternchen bestickt.“
